Circle Targets $7.2 Billion Valuation in Upcoming IPO

Circle’s potential public listing could advance the stablecoin market, boosting acceptance among traditional financial users.

Circle, known for the USDC stablecoin, has increased its IPO plans, seeking a valuation of $7.2 billion and listing under the symbol “CRCL”. Institutional buyers like BlackRock show interest, potentially invigorating the market. The company has engaged leading banks including JPMorgan to underwrite the offering.


Circle’s offering increased to 32 million shares, priced between $27 and $28 each. Institutional commitments indicate strong demand, reflecting rising investment in stablecoins. The potential market impact extends to financial institutions adopting stablecoin-related operations. JPMorgan Analyst, Kabba Kahn, noted, “A successful IPO for Circle would further advance the development of the US stablecoin market while accelerating the acceptance of stablecoins by traditional financial users, particularly institutional ones”.
